Current Conditions and Heat Index

It is currently Saturday overnight in Melissa, TX, and the air remains quite humid. The current air temperature is 82F, but the feels-like temperature is 87F due to a relative humidity of 70% and a dew point of 72F. Winds are light at 6 mph with gusts reaching 20 mph, and the sky is clear.

Weekend Forecast

Today will be sunny with a high near 97F and a low near 77F. The chance of precipitation is just 1%. However, the heat index will reach as high as 104F. South southwest winds will blow between 5 to 10 mph.

Tonight, conditions will remain mostly clear with a low around 77F. Temperatures may rise slightly to around 79F overnight. The heat index will stay high, reaching up to 103F. South winds will continue at 5 to 10 mph.

Tomorrow brings a high near 96F and a low near 74F. The sky will be mostly sunny, but the chance of precipitation rises to 41%. A slight chance of rain showers is expected between 10am and 1pm, followed by a chance of showers and thunderstorms between 1pm and 4pm. Heat index values could peak at 105F. South southwest winds will be around 5 mph. New rainfall amounts less than a tenth of an inch are possible.

Tomorrow night, showers and thunderstorms will be likely before 7pm, with a chance continuing afterward. The sky will be mostly cloudy with a low around 74F. Temperatures may rise to around 76F overnight. Southeast winds will be calm, between 0 to 5 mph. The chance of precipitation is 60%.

Safety Reminder

With heat index values exceeding 100F, it is crucial to stay hydrated and limit midday exertion. Check on neighbors and vulnerable individuals during the heat. As humidity remains high, be aware that the perceived temperature is significantly higher than the actual air temperature.
